Oracle Globale GLAS-Datensammlung (Global License Advisory Services)
Von der Anwendung ServiceNow Discovery wird das von Oracle geprüfte Muster „GLAS Data Collection“ zur Erkennung von Oracle GLAS-Daten verwendet. Diese Daten umfassen erkannte Oracle Datenbank-, Middleware- und Java-Konfigurationselemente.
- Oracle Datenbank für UNIX - und Windows -Muster
- Oracle Middleware auf Linux für die folgenden Muster:
- Oracle Tuxedo
- WebLogic
- Linux
- Oracle Java-on-Java-Installationsmuster
Besuchen Sie die ServiceNow Store-Website, um alle verfügbaren Apps anzuzeigen und Informationen zum Senden von Anforderungen an den Store zu erhalten. Kumulative Informationen zum Release für alle veröffentlichten Apps finden Sie in den Release-Hinweisen zum ServiceNow Store-Versionsverlauf.
Einzelheiten zum Anzeigen und Herunterladen der gesammelten Oracle GLAS-Daten finden Sie unter Oracle GLAS-Daten (Global License Advisory Services) herunterladen.
Voraussetzungen
Die Muster Datenbank Oracle und Middleware führen die Mustererweiterungen aus, und die gesammelten Daten werden in den Tabellen ServiceNow für GLAS-Daten gespeichert. Das Muster Oracle GLAS Data Collection Database kann ab Release [ Now Platform in Paris verwendet werden. Das Muster für die GLAS Data Collection Middleware Oracle kann ab dem Release [ Now Platform in Rome verwendet werden. Das Java-Muster Oracle kann für Now Platform ab Release Washington DC verwendet werden.
- Unterstützte Versionen Oracle.
- Informationen zu den unterstützten Versionen von Oraclefinden Sie unter Detailinformationen über die mittels ITOM-Transparenz erkannten Produkte.
- Store-App Oracle Global Licensing and Advisory Services
- Navigieren zu und installieren Sie das Plugin „Data Collection for Oracle Global Licensing and Advisory Services“.
- Die Mindestversion für die Datenbanksammlung ist 1.4.0
- Die Mindestversion für die Middleware-Sammlung ist 1.7.1
- Die Mindestversion für die Java-Sammlung ist 1.8.4
Hinweis:Voraussetzung für das Plugin „Data Collection for Oracle Global Licensing and Advisory Services“ ist, dass das Discovery-Plugin (com.snc.discovery) ordnungsgemäß funktioniert. - Andere bereitzustellende ServiceNow-Apps
-
- Muster für Discovery und Service-Mapping
- CMDB CI-Klassenmodelle
- Anmeldeinformationen
- Stellen Sie sicher, dass Sie über die folgenden Anmeldeinformationen verfügen:
- Windows und UNIX Discovery mit PowerShell/WMI/SSH.Hinweis:PowerShell- und WMI-Anmeldeinformationen sind nur für die Datenbanksammlung erforderlich.
- Applicative-Anmeldeinformationen für die Oracle-Instanz (cmdb_ci_db_ora_instance)
- (Optional) Anmeldeinformationen für virtuelle Computer Stellen Sie sicher, dass Sie über die entsprechenden Anmeldeinformationen verfügen, um Hardwaredaten für Computer zu sammeln, die auf den folgenden virtuellen Providern gehostet werden:
- VMware
- Nutanix
- IBM
- Hyper-V
- Windows und UNIX Discovery mit PowerShell/WMI/SSH.
- Berechtigungen im Betriebssystem
- Stellen Sie sicher, dass Sie unter /tmptemporäre Dateien schreiben können. Verifizieren Sie außerdem, dass Sie die folgenden Betriebssystembefehle ausführen können:
- ls
- cat
- ps
- Oracle-Berechtigungen
- Vergewissern Sie sich, dass die Applicative-Anmeldeinformationen über die folgenden Berechtigungen verfügen:
- Leseberechtigungen für die Datei tnsnames.ora
- Berechtigungen zum Ausführen des Befehls sqlplus
- (Für Middleware-Sammlung) Sudo-Berechtigungen zum Ausführen des folgenden Befehls:
sudo Su - oracle -c "$ORACLE_INSTANCE/bin/opmnctl status"
Datenbank-CI-Beziehungen
| CI | Beziehung/Referenz | CI |
|---|---|---|
| cmdb_ci_orcl_vsession |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
| cmdb_ci_ora_lms_detail |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
| cmdb_ci_ora_lms_overview |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
| cmdb_ci_orcl_options |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
| cmdb_ci_orcl_dba_users |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
| cmdb_ci_orcl_vlicense | Enthält::Enthalten in | cmdb_ci_db_ora_instance |
Tuxedo-Middleware-Erweiterung
- *_InstallLog.log
- *ubbc*
- bdmconfig*
- comps.xml
- dmconfig*
- JSconfig.xml
- lic.txt
- registry.xml
- tuxconfig*
- tuxwsvr.ini
- BBL
- DBBL
- GWWS
- JSH
- JSL
- TMJAVASVR
- TMMETADATA
WebLogic-Middleware-Erweiterung
- beahomelist
- biee-domain.xml
- cluster.properties
- comps.xml
- config.xml
- domain-registry.xml
- opmn.xml
- portalconfig.xml
- pthome.xml
- registry.xml
- server.xml
- sessions.xml
- setupinfo.txt
- WebLogic
- OAS
- SOA
- OBI
- WebCenter
- FormulareBerichte
| WebLogic | OAS | OBI | ||||
|---|---|---|---|---|---|---|
| startWebLogic | httpd | f90 | iooomgrrmi | r30rbe32 | rwrqm60 | nqsserver |
| Java | Apache | frmweb | javaw | r30rqm32 | rwrqm | sawserver |
| startWLS | Java | ifbld60 | Java | r30run32 | rwrun60 | coreapplication_obijh1 |
| nodemanager | opmn | ifbld90 | jre | r30sxc32 | rwserver | nqscheduler |
| beasvc | dis3 | ifcgi60 | oad | r30sxu32 | rwsxc60 | nqsclustercontroller |
| beasvc64 | dis4 | ifcmp60 | odisrv | rwbld60 | rwsxu60 | essbase |
| beasvcX64 | dis51pr | ifcmp90 | ofcguard | rwbuilder | vdeserver | essvr |
| oraclesvc | dis51ws | ifctrl60 | oidrepld | rwcgi60 | webcachea | essbasestudio |
| opmn | dis51 | ifdbg60 | oidmon | rwcli60 | webcached | hyperion |
| wlsvc | dwfde61 | ifrun60 | oidldapd | rwcon60 | webcache | |
| wlsvc64 | f45des | ifsrv60 | opmn | rwconverter | ||
| wlsvcX64 | f45run | ifwdb60 | r30cli32 | rwisv60 | ||
| jmc | f50dbg32 | ifweb60 | r30con32 | rwmts60 | ||
| httpd | f50run32 | ifweb90 | r30isv32 | rwqmu60 | ||
| jrmc | f60 | imapds | r30qmu32 | rwrbe60 | ||
Middleware-CI-Beziehungen
| CI | Beziehung/Referenz | CI |
|---|---|---|
| cmdb_ci_ora_lms_overview | Enthält::Enthalten in | cmdb_ci_linux_server |
| cmdb_ci_config_file_tracked | Enthält::Enthalten in | cmdb_ci_linux_server |
Diese Beziehungen werden von einer Containment-Regel erstellt, die die gültigen Objekte beschreibt, die in den Linux-CIs enthalten sein können.
Mit der Middleware-Datenerfassungsanwendung installierte Eigenschaften
| Systemeigenschaft | Standardwert | Beschreibung |
|---|---|---|
| sn_itom_oracleglas.isMaskingIp | wahr | Bestimmt, ob die IP-Adresse in nachverfolgten Middleware-Dateien Oracle maskiert werden soll, indem der Wert durch „text_removed“ ersetzt wird. |
| sn_itom_oracleglas.isMaskingUserName | wahr | Bestimmt, ob der Anwendername in nachverfolgten Middleware-Dateien Oracle maskiert werden soll, indem der Wert durch „text_removed“ ersetzt wird. |
| sn_itom_oracleglas.isMaskingPort | wahr | Bestimmt, ob der Port in nachverfolgten Middleware-Dateien Oracle maskiert werden soll, indem der Wert durch „text_removed“ ersetzt wird. |
Steuern Sie die Datensammlung der Middleware
Die folgende boolesche Systemeigenschaft kann die Middleware-Dateisammlung deaktivieren: sn_itom_pattern.glas.disable_file_collection
Steuern Sie die GLAS-Datenerfassung
Die folgende Eigenschaft MID-Server steuert die GLAS-Datensammlung: sn_itom_pattern.disable_glas_data_collection
Diese Eigenschaft ist standardmäßig auf false festgelegt.
Oracle Discovery des Java-Prozesses
ITOM-Transparenz kann Java-laufende Prozesse in Ihrer Infrastruktur erkennen, sodass Sie Oracle-Lizenzvereinbarungen einhalten und sich auf GLAS-Audits vorbereiten können. Sie können die Discovery entweder mit dem Muster Java installation (IP-basiert) oder mit Agent Client Collectordurchführen. Im Muster-Flow werden die Java-Prozesse von Application Dependency Mapping (ADM) erkannt. Wenn die -Prozesse erkannt werden, wird das Muster Java installation ausgelöst und die Daten werden gesammelt. Im ACC-Flow werden die Prozesse von ACC erkannt, was die ACC-Anwendungsmuster auslöst und die Daten sammelt. Weitere Informationen zu Mustern mit ACC finden Sie unter: Anwendungsmuster für Agent Client Collector
- Alle Anwender müssen über die Store-App Oracle GLAS ab Version 1.8.4 verfügen.
- Agent Client Collector Anwender:
- Muss das Store-Plugin Agent Client Collector Framework enthalten.
- Für zusätzliche Daten kann das Store-Plugin Agent Client Collector Visibility – Inhalt Inhalt vorhanden sein.
- Informationen zum Zugriff privilegierter Benutzer finden Sie unter KB1705845
Hinweis:Oracle Java-Discovery mit ACC gilt in allen Serverumgebungen. Derzeit wird sie jedoch für andere Desktopumgebungen teilweise unterstützt. Im folgenden KB-Artikel finden Sie ein Update Set für Windows Desktop. KB1705845
- Erfasste Daten
-
Tabelle : 2. Java-Audit [ora_java_audit] Feld Beschreibung Name Name des Datensatzes. Beispiel: Java@hostname Name des physischen Computers Name des Host-CI Rechnertyp Entweder Server(S) oder Desktop(D) Java-Herausgeber/-Laufzeitanbieter Java-Lieferantenname Betriebssystem Betriebssystem, in dem Java ausgeführt wird Umgebungstyp Produktions-, Entwicklungs- oder QA-Umgebung Java-Release/-Version/-Build Java-Version Installationspfad Absoluter Installationspfad der Java-Binärdatei Installationsdatum (DateTime) Datum und Uhrzeit der Erstellung der Java-Binärdatei im Dateisystem Releasedatei (J/N) Gibt an, ob eine release.md- Datei in der Installation vorhanden ist Prozessormarke/-modell Prozessormodellname Sockets (Ganzzahl) Anzahl der CPU-Sockel Kerne (Ganzzahl) Anzahl der CPU-Kerne V6 und früher Gibt an, ob Sie eine Java-Version 6 oder früher haben Open Source Gibt an, ob Sie über eine Open-Source-Java-Installation verfügen Schalten Sie kommerzielle Funktionen frei Gibt an, ob für Sie die gewerblichen Funktionen (wie JFR) aktiviert haben Missionssteuerung Gibt an, ob das Missionssteuerungs-Plugin aktiviert ist AMC-Agent Gibt an, ob das AMC-Agent-Plugin aktiviert ist Nutzungs-Tracker Gibt an, ob die Funktion „Nutzungstracker“ aktiviert ist Objekt-ID der VM Objekt-ID der VM-Instanz PID PID des laufenden Prozesses IP-Adresse IP-Adresse des Hosts/der VM Zuerst erkannt Das Datum der ersten Discovery Neuester Discovery-Scan Das Datum der neuesten Discovery Discovery-Quelle Die Discovery-Methode. Anwendung Verweis auf die Tabelle [cmdb_ci_appl]. Softwareinstallation Verweis auf die Tabelle [cmdb_sam_sw_install]. Java-Beweis Verweis auf die Tabelle [cmdb_ora_java_evidence]. Host Verweis auf die Tabelle [cmdb_ci]. - Java-Nachweis [ora_java_evidence]
-
Feld Beschreibung Laufender Prozess Verweis auf die Tabelle [cmdb_running_process]. Host-CI Verweis auf die Tabelle [cmdb_ci_computer]. Datei-Informationen Verweis auf die Tabelle [cmdb_file_information].
Laden Sie den Oracle GLAS-Bericht in Discovery-Administratorarbeitsbereich herunter. Weitere Informationen finden Sie unter Oracle GLAS-Daten (Global License Advisory Services) herunterladen.
Oracle GLAS Data Collection – Dashboard
Nachdem Discovery die Erkennung der Komponenten Ihrer Datenbank- oder Middleware-Bereitstellung abgeschlossen hat, können Sie die relevanten Statistiken im Dashboard Oracle „ GLAS-Datensammlung anzeigen.
Nach dem Upgrade auf Discovery-Administratorarbeitsbereich Version 1.3.1 (Store August 2024) können Sie zu navigieren und verwenden Sie das erweiterte Dashboard.